Comments for Sample AD28964 - Analysis $GCMS

Westchester Dept, of Labs & Research User Vinci, David L Date: 12-15-2001 Time: 09:19:27

A GCMS scan, from 35 to 550 amu, does not reveal the presence of unusual compounds, except for the presence of bis(2-Ethylhexyl)phthalate at an estimated level of 0.43 ug/L. It is also present in the Laboratory Blank at 0.41 ug/L. Recoveries for 5 of the 43 compounds in the LCS Standard were above their acceptance ranges. This sample was received with a pH of less than 2.
